WebSep 18, 2024 · In FMC we have two tools we can utilize to harness external feeds. … WebDec 3, 2015 · Each access control policy has Security Intelligence options. You can whitelist or blacklist network objects, URL objects and lists, and Security Intelligence feeds and lists, all of which you can constrain by security zone. You can also associate a DNS policy with your access control policy, and whitelist or blacklist domain names.

WebCisco 3000 Series Industrial Security Appliances (ISA), Cisco Firepower 1000 Series, … WebDec 29, 2016 · Security Intelligence is a first line of defense against malicious Internet content. This feature allows you to immediately blacklist (block) connections based on the latest reputation intelligence. WebJan 19, 2024 · Options. 01-20-2024 12:34 AM. SI updates normally happen every 2 hours by default. They are separate from product and rule updates. Check under the Objects for the feed objects and ensure the update frequency has not been set to "none".
